Backyard Escape: English Garden Folly

A mix of materials, including brick, bluestone, wicker, and wood, make this an ideal space for classic summer entertaining.

Architecture

A brick retaining wall in the backyard became the rear wall for the folly, which is tucked into a perennial garden. Gracefully arched rough-sawn cedar columns, a slate roof, and copper finials add to the distinctive look. The steep roofline provides the proper scale for the yard, while the vaulted ceiling within lets hot air rise for comfort.
